Large basement anti-floating anchor rod structure and construction method
The invention relates to a large basement anti-floating anchor rod structure and a construction method. The construction method comprises the steps that anchor rod hole site measurement and soil body treatment are conducted; performing anchor rod drilling construction; performing anchor rod grouting construction; performing an anchor rod anti-pulling test; performing waterproof treatment on the anchor rod. The anchor rod guiding and positioning support has the beneficial effects that the anchor rod guiding and positioning support is adopted for guiding, positioning and mounting the anchor rod and the grouting pipe, and the mounting construction efficiency and mounting and positioning precision of the anchor rod are improved; a drill rod with a dust collection air bag is adopted for drilling construction of an anchor rod anchoring hole, and the dust collection air bag is used for collecting dust in the anchor rod drilling construction process; a steel pressing plate, a rubber pad and a soil nail are adopted to seal the hole opening of the anchoring hole of the anchor rod, so that the grouting construction quality of the anchor rod is improved; a shaped experimental device is adopted for carrying out an anchor rod anti-pulling test, a combined waterproof technology is adopted for an anti-floating anchor rod part, and the overall waterproof effect of the anti-floating anchor rod part on a bottom plate structure is improved.
